Top Nutrients and Health Benefits of Eating Watermelon:

This juicy fruit isn’t just sweet to taste; it is rich in multiple health benefits. Every 100 grams of watermelon contains about 92% water, which works excellently to keep the body hydrated. One cup of watermelon has fewer than 46 calories, making it a great addition for those aiming for weight management.

Because of its high water content and fiber, it keeps you full for longer, reducing the urge to snack and helping control calorie intake. Watermelon is also packed with lycopene, citrulline, vitamin A, vitamin C, potassium, magnesium, and fiber—ingredients that not only cool the body but also boost digestion, relieve constipation, and help manage blood pressure.

Not only the red flesh but even the white layer and green rind of watermelon are full of health-boosting elements.

Benefits of Watermelon:

Moreover, watermelon is rich in antioxidants that protect your body’s cells, support heart health, and help enhance skin radiance. One less-known fact is that citrulline, an amino acid found in watermelon, increases oxygen delivery to muscles, reduces fatigue, and enhances physical performance. Scientific studies show that citrulline can effectively reduce tiredness and improve body function.

Here Are Some Surprising Health Benefits of Watermelon:
1. Natural Hydration Booster

Additionally, with nearly 92% water content, watermelon keeps the body cool and hydrated in the heat. It reduces the risk of dehydration and protects against heatstroke. That’s why watermelon for hydration is an ideal natural remedy.

2. Keeps the Heart Fit

Moreover, lycopene, potassium, and magnesium in watermelon help regulate blood pressure, improve arterial flexibility, and reduce the risk of heart disease.

3. Helps Prevent Cancer

Watermelon’s antioxidants, especially lycopene and vitamin C, prevent oxidative damage to cells and help inhibit the formation of cancer cells.

4. A Friend to the Digestive System

In addition, high in fiber and water, watermelon keeps the digestive system active and helps prevent constipation.

5. Improves Vision

Moreover, vitamin A and lycopene protect the eye cells, keep the retina healthy, and help reduce age-related vision loss.

6. Naturally Brightens the Skin

Watermelon benefits for skin include improved collagen production due to vitamin C, which keeps skin bright, smooth, firm, and youthful.

7. Reduces Muscle Fatigue

Citrulline in watermelon enhances blood flow and oxygen supply to muscles, significantly reducing post-exercise fatigue and soreness.

8. Supports Weight Control

Due to low calories and high fiber, watermelon keeps the stomach full for longer and reduces unnecessary eating—making watermelon for weight loss a natural option.

9. Improves Mood

In addition, watermelon helps calm the nerves, reduce mental stress, and uplift the mood—it works like a natural tonic for the brain.

10. Boosts Immunity

Vitamins B6 and C strengthen the immune system and help fight off viruses and bacteria, making benefits of eating watermelon even more powerful.

11. Helps Control Blood Pressure

Moreover, citrulline relaxes blood vessels, and potassium helps maintain stable blood pressure levels.

12. Supports Kidney Health

Potassium and water content in watermelon help cleanse the kidneys and prevent the buildup of uric acid.

13. Relieves Asthma Symptoms

Vitamin A and antioxidants in watermelon protect the lungs, ease breathing, and reduce the risk of asthma attacks.

14. Fights Signs of Aging

Lycopene, Vitamin A, and C help reduce wrinkles and keep the skin youthful—further emphasizing watermelon benefits for skin.

15. Watermelon Seeds Benefits

Don’t throw away the seeds! Watermelon seeds are rich in iron, magnesium, and zinc, beneficial for skin, hair, and even in preventing anemia. Watermelon for hair health is also supported by these nutrients.

16. Beneficial for Pregnant Women

Watermelon contains folate, magnesium, and water, which help keep the body cool and aid digestion during pregnancy.

Some Precautions While Eating Watermelon:
  • Watermelon contains natural sugar, so people with diabetes should consume it in moderation.
  • Overeating may cause digestive issues, and it’s best not to eat it on an empty stomach as it may cause gas or bloating.
  • Eating too much cold watermelon can cause cold symptoms, especially in children, so be cautious.
